Teen Charged in Violent Church Staircase Robbery in Queens has Lengthy Criminal History

JAMAICA, Queens, New York City – A 16-year-old suspect accused of violently shoving a senior citizen down the stairs of a church in Queens during a robbery is now facing charges of robbery and assault. The teen, who had to be hospitalized after attempting self-harm, will be arraigned once released.

Despite being arraigned as an adult, the identity of the 16-year-old will not be disclosed due to his age, according to the Queens District Attorneys Office. The suspect has had nine prior arrests in Queens as a juvenile offender, with most of them related to robberies.

The incident took place outside St. Demetrios Greek Orthodox Church in Jamaica Hills, where the victim, 68-year-old Irene Tahliambouris, was brutally attacked while on her way to church. Surveillance footage captured the suspect forcefully pushing her down the stairs, resulting in a fractured skull and other injuries. The assailant then stole her belongings, including her car keys and cellphone.

Following the attack, the victim’s car, a 2006 Nissan Altima, was recovered by the police about 3.5 miles away from the church. The suspect is also being investigated for other crimes in the neighborhood, including an attempted robbery of an elderly person, and a separate incident where he allegedly stole another woman’s car.
